Repairing Your Smile with Dental Implants

Teeth play more of a role in your life than simply chewing your food. They affect your overall health, speech, and self-esteem as well. When any teeth are missing, it will likely make you feel uncomfortable and desire to find a way to restore your smile. Luckily, dental implants can come to the rescue.

One of the latest and best treatment options for missing teeth are dental implants. They provide a permanent, comfortable, and natural-looking restoration. Implants allow patients to avoid some of the hassles associated with dentures or bridges, such as slipping appliances or tedious cleaning. Not every patient is a good candidate for implants though, as dentists must perform a complete dental examination and medical history to ensure the patient would likely be a successful implant patient. Jaw bone condition, as well as general health, are both of utmost concern.

If a patient is determined to be an acceptable implant candidate, the procedure involves surgically inserting a titanium post into the jaw bone. It might be one post for a single missing tooth, or more posts for multiple teeth. It serves as an anchor to support the complete implant. A portion of the post is above the gum line to create an abutment for the dental implant, or crown that will be placed on top.

The area must completely heal before the implant can be finalized. Healing usually takes a few months, allowing the titanium post to fuse with the jaw bone. Once healing is complete, an artificial tooth or crown may be placed on top and the restoration will be functional and attractive.

With proper maintenance, dental implants will last for many years. Care involves normal brushing and flossing, and regular dental checkups and cleanings. Your dentist will make sure that you continue to have good fit and use of the implant, and watch for any damage or problems that might arise. Early detection and repair of issues will allow you to enjoy good oral health and a beautiful smile.
